On June 3, information from the Hanoi Traffic Management and Operation Center (Tramoc) - Hanoi Department of Construction said that after implementing the prescribed ordering procedures, on June 5, 2025, Vinbus Eco-T transportation Service Company Limited will organize the opening ceremony, putting bus route No. 43 into operation to serve the travel needs of the people.
Bus No. 43 uses an average electric bus with a capacity of 60 seats, running on the Kim Ma - Dong Anh Town route (Dong Anh district, Hanoi).




Bus route 43: Kim Ma (No. 1 Kim Ma) - Giang Vo - Hao Nam - O Cho Dua - Kham Thien - Nguyen Thuong Hien - Tran Binh Dao - Quang Trung - Ly Thuong Kiet - Phan Chu Trinh - Ly Thai To - Ngo Quyen - Hang Voi - Hang Tre - Hang Muoi - Tran Nhat Duat - Yen Phu - Long Bien - Yen Phu - Tran Nhat Duat transit point - Chuong Duong bridge - Nguyen Van Cu - Ly Son - Dong Tru - Truong Sa bridge - Dau Canh intersection - National Highway 3 - Cao Lo - Dong Anh town (3 attractions closely to Dong Anh) and vice versa.
Driving frequency: 15-20 minutes/trip; operating time from 5:00 to 9:00; ticket price is 12,000 VND/passenger/trip.


According to the Hanoi Traffic Management and Operation Center, the addition of 15 medium-sized electric buses to operation on bus route No. 43 has increased the total number of electric and green energy buses in Hanoi to 360 vehicles (241 electric buses and 139 CNG buses), accounting for 20.3% of the total number of subsidized vehicles, continuing to improve the quality of buses.
At the same time, this is also the basis for developing norms and unit prices for the remaining type of electric bus, aiming to convert the entire fleet of buses to buses using electricity and green energy according to the project approved by the Hanoi People's Committee.
